Our Commercial Installation Process

From first survey to ongoing support, here’s how a commercial project runs.

1

Free Survey & Assessment

An engineer visits your site to assess roof structure, electrical infrastructure and your demand profile, then provides an itemised written proposal and a clear commercial case.

2

System Design and Approval

We design a system tailored to your building and energy use, walk you through the commercial case and options, and handle any DNO or grid application required for a commercial connection.

3

Installation

Our MCS-certified team installs and commissions the system to an agreed schedule that minimises disruption, working to commercial health-and-safety and access requirements throughout.

4

Sign-Off and Aftercare

You receive certification, monitoring and full handover, plus ongoing support and optional planned maintenance to keep the system performing.

Compliant, Certified and Fully Documented

Commercial installations come with paperwork and compliance that a business needs done properly: structural sign-off where required, electrical certification, MCS certification, DNO notification and the documentation your insurers, auditors and any future buyer will expect. We handle all of it and hand you a complete record, so your system isn’t just installed, it’s properly accounted for.

One accountable team also means that if anything needs attention later, you’ve got a single point of contact who knows your system, rather than chasing a subcontractor who’s long gone.
